As far as hit calling complaints, two things... first adrenaline affects not only pain threshold but judgement. You may not feel a hit or two that only hit fabric and not skin behind it, and second sometimes people all jacked up make poor decisions they wouldn't normally do even in another game situation. There is a difference between "i was panicked and made a bad decision, my bad" and being a dirty dirty cheater. One is not intentional the other isn't.
As far as "yelling" goes. The field is noisy, there is gunfire and people talking and running around. Trying to have a calm talk with someone isn't going to happen on the field and it shouldn't be taken personally unless someone is up in your face screaming and pointing fingers in your face. If this happens call a ref and someone is going to sit down or go home.
Lastly on ref calls. Like football refs don't always have the right angle or a clear view. We don't have instant replay. Sometimes the calls work against you, sometimes for you. It is what it is and don't read too much into it. The refs have a hard job and do the best they can.
